The scene depicts an indoor mushroom cultivation facility in Karizak, Afghanistan. A young adult male stands on the right, positioned to the left of a wooden shelving unit holding numerous mushroom grow bags. The male wears a dark turban, a light brown long-sleeved tunic, a dark blue scarf, and a brown plaid waistcoat. His eyes are partially closed, and he has a mustache and a short beard. He wears open-toed sandals. The shelving unit, constructed from light-colored wood, occupies the left half of the frame. It supports multiple clear plastic bags filled with a light brown substrate, likely sawdust or straw inoculated with mycelium. Several clusters of mature, light-colored oyster mushrooms are visible, emerging from perforations in the bags on the upper shelves. Additional bags are suspended from or rest on the lower shelves. Some bags are secured with red string. Small, empty clear plastic bags are also tied to the wooden structure. The background features a plain, light brown wall, possibly mud or plaster, with two electrical outlets visible. The floor is covered by a blue tarp or mat.
